What Is Data Residency?
Data residency is the place where an organization stores data, whether that is physically or geographically. It is similar to data sovereignty and data localization, but not the same.
Data residency is about the physical location of data. Data sovereignty is an issue when considering the laws and jurisdiction of that data as a result of its location. Data localization can be expanded to specify that some types of data be held in a specific country.
These differences are gaining vital significance for Indian businesses. Some organizations might require more transparency in processing and/or storing their information, depending on the type of information, industry needs, contractual requirements, and regulations applicable.
That’s where cloud data residency comes into play. Cloud-based infrastructure users need to be aware of the cloud service provider and also the geographical location of the workloads and cloud resources.

Stronger Data Governance
The ability to gain better visibility into the location of information and processing is one of the most significant advantages of data residency.
In Indian infrastructure, workloads allow for the creation of more defined internal policies on data handling, access, backup, and operations. IT teams can also more easily document the locations of infrastructure in their internal governance frameworks or to meet compliance requirements.
Just because data is hosted in India does not necessarily mean that it will comply with regulations. There are many factors, such as the security controls, applicable laws, retention policies, organization policies, etc., that can affect compliance.
However, geographic clarity can make the governance dialogue easier.
Supporting Privacy and Regulatory Requirements
The privacy landscape is changing rapidly in today’s digital world. There is an increased demand from businesses for responsible information management of customers and organisations.
Indian organisations might face personal data protection requirements, industry-specific regulations, contractual data-handling stipulations or internal corporate policies. With the Indian data center, an infrastructure arrangement can be created that is more aligned with the organizations that are looking for data storage in India.
But, businesses should not use geography as a compliance replacement for servers. Fundamentals of encryption, access management, audit logging, vulnerability management, backups, incident response and proper retention practices still apply.
Data residency is just a part of a bigger governance framework.

Business Continuity and Operational Visibility
Data residency can also affect business operations.
Organizations tend to keep extensive information regarding the location of production environments, backup locations, disaster-recovery systems, and replicated datasets. Keeping critical infrastructure within known geographic boundaries can make infrastructure mapping more straightforward.
It is particularly useful during audits, vendor evaluations, security evaluations and business continuity drills.
Nevertheless, there is still the issue of redundancy. A robust system architecture should include several availability zones, separate geographic backup, monitoring, failover and recovery capabilities.

When Should Businesses Consider Indian Hosting?
Indian hosting can be particularly compelling when:
- Most of the visitors of the website are from India.
- Low latency database interactions are critical to applications.
- Data handling is a priority for the organization.
- Customers want transparency when it comes to data storage locations.
- There are sector-specific rules for governance.
- IT staff want to know more about the geography of infrastructure.
On the other hand, companies that clearly serve customers in multiple regions may be better served by a multi-region approach, using content delivery networks, distributed infrastructure and distributed systems that are redundant around the globe.
